AT&T’s WarnerMedia has brought on a startup to help it get HBO Max into more places. The entertainment arm of the Dallas company has acquired Canada-based You.i TV, a provider of cross-platform development tools for television and media companies, according to a statement. Terms were not disclosed for the deal, even as WarnerMedia has been an investor in the company since 2016, prior to AT&T’s acquisition of Time Warner in 2018.
